Before adding a normalize retry directive to attempt debug data, the runner
requires a nonblank, valid UTF-8 reason code of at most 128 bytes and a
nonblank, valid UTF-8 message of at most 4,096 bytes. These are encoded-byte
limits. The framework rejects an invalid directive without truncating or
rewriting either field. It validates only this mechanical contract; normalizers
remain responsible for ensuring their otherwise valid diagnostics do not expose
source material, credentials, paths, names, or other sensitive content.
